exquisite

/ɪkˈskwɪzɪt/
Dictionary

noun

  • Fop, dandy.

adjective

  • Especially fine or pleasing; exceptional.

    "Sourav Ganguly scored an exquisite century in his debut Test match."

  • Carefully adjusted; precise; accurate; exact.
  • Recherché; far-fetched; abstruse.
  • Of special beauty or rare excellence.
  • Exceeding; extreme; keen, in a bad or a good sense.

    "exquisite pain or pleasure"

  • Of delicate perception or close and accurate discrimination; not easy to satisfy; exact; fastidious.

    "exquisite judgment, taste, or discernment"
